Adventist Health hopes to save $100 million with GE Healthcare

Roseville-based Adventist Health is setting out to reach $100 million in savings through a new partnership with GE Healthcare. The new partnership, announced Tuesday, will see GE Healthcare deploy new efficiency measures throughout Adventist Health’s hospitals and clinics. GE Healthcare, the medical arm of General Electric Co. (NYSE: GE), specializes in imaging equipment for X-rays and CT scans.
